Output 22cc6575336fae0b0e5d3187647d88cd208c6d8fa67efc984fd62f733be81f71:6

value
18624246
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ed31190527111181c7ebdf2825a2dffe5ed2ded OP_EQUALVERIFY OP_CHECKSIG
address
12MPJzQ9Zfv6bQCidoTop71FHpj5kk9zPn
transaction
22cc6575336fae0b0e5d3187647d88cd208c6d8fa67efc984fd62f733be81f71
spent
true